Moated site, enclosures and water management features is a medieval monument located in Gloucestershire, England, designated as a scheduled ancient monument under list entry 1003588. The site comprises a moated enclosure with associated earthwork features, typical of medieval defensive and residential settlement patterns in the region, dating to the medieval period. The water management features integral to the site demonstrate the practical engineering approaches adopted by medieval landholders, with the moat serving both defensive and drainage functions. Such sites are significant archaeological resources for understanding medieval settlement hierarchy, land use, and the relationship between water control and domestic or manorial organisation in the English countryside.
